<paragraph id="8BE44E5E81310D2424E6AAAEFA0CFD13" blockId="26.[151,1437,356,1928]" pageId="26" pageNumber="27">
Note: the
<typeStatus id="54E0F0FC81310D242514AAB1FE12FE66" box="[309,412,463,488]" pageId="26" pageNumber="27" type="lectotype">lectotype</typeStatus>
was designated from USNM material but should have been designated from the material in the MNHN, the main depository of Marchals material, as suggested in recommendation 74D of the International Code of Zoological Nomenclature that was current at the time that the work was undertaken (International Code of Zoological Nomenclature (International Commission on Zoological Nomenclature (1961)) but was ignored by Lambdin and Kosztarab. The same recommendation still applies as Recommendation 74D in the present International Code of Zoological Nomenclature (International Commission on Zoological Nomenclature (1999).
</paragraph>

<paragraph id="8BE44E5E81310D2424E6A98EFF6DFCC1" blockId="26.[151,1437,356,1928]" pageId="26" pageNumber="27">
<emphasis id="B92F924C81310D2424E6A98EFE27FC86" bold="true" box="[199,425,751,776]" pageId="26" pageNumber="27">Mounted material.</emphasis>
Body large, roundly pear-shaped, about as wide as long, with only anal lobes extending posteriorly; length
<quantity id="4CA3E3BB81310D24254AA86AFE4DFCA2" box="[363,451,788,812]" metricMagnitude="-3" metricUnit="m" metricValue="3.1" pageId="26" pageNumber="27" unit="mm" value="3.1">3.1 mm</quantity>
, width
<quantity id="4CA3E3BB81310D242634A86AFDE0FCA2" box="[533,622,788,812]" metricMagnitude="-3" metricUnit="m" metricValue="2.9" pageId="26" pageNumber="27" unit="mm" value="2.9">2.9 mm</quantity>
. Derm with numerous, large oval areolations, most with a tubular duct in centre.
</paragraph>
<paragraph id="8BE44E5E81310D2424E6A823FE68FAE3" blockId="26.[151,1437,356,1928]" pageId="26" pageNumber="27">
<emphasis id="B92F924C81310D2424E6A823FEA0FCFA" bold="true" box="[199,302,861,884]" pageId="26" pageNumber="27">Dorsum.</emphasis>
Derm unsclerotized but with large oval areolations. Eight-shaped pores of 3 sizes: (i) a large rounded pore, each
<date id="FFE5689E81310D242532A8FEFEE1FC19" box="[275,367,896,920]" pageId="26" pageNumber="27" value="2013-10-20">1320 x</date>
913 µm, very sparsely distributed almost throughout but with greatest concentrations around stigmatic pore bands and medially dorsad to mouthparts; also with 811 on each side of posterior abdominal segments; (ii) much smaller, intermediate-sized pore, each 8
<date id="FFE5689E81310D242769A8B6FCE5FC51" box="[840,875,968,992]" pageId="26" pageNumber="27">9 x</date>
5 µm, rather evenly distributed throughout rest of dorsum; and (iii) smallest pore, each 5
<date id="FFE5689E81310D242649A892FD00FB8A" box="[616,654,1004,1028]" pageId="26" pageNumber="27">6 x</date>
4 µm, with 24 associated with apex of each stigmatic pore band. Simple pores, each 34 µm wide; sparse. Cribriform plates roundish, each small, 410 µm wide with quite large micropores, in 6 or 7 sparse transverse bands, possibly restricted to abdomen (see under Comments below). Dorsal setae few, each setose, showing nothing distinctive. Tubular ducts appearing to arise mainly from centre of each dermal areolation; each outer ductule about 28 µm long, inner ductules quite short; outer ducts only slightly broader than those on venter; abundant throughout. Anal lobes mainly membranous, sclerotizations restricted to inner margins, without obvious folding; setae as follows: apical seta both broken; dorsal fleshy setae all somewhat bent; more apical setae 2328 µm long; more basal setae 30 µm long; setae near apex on ventral surface 22 µm long; medioventral setae or outer margin setae 12-20 µm long; each lobe with 2 small 8-shaped pores. Median anal plate oddly shaped but with a blunt apex, about 28 µm long, maybe 40 µm wide at base. Anal ring with 4 pairs of setae, each about 75 µm long.
</paragraph>

<subSubSection id="C3411DD581370D2224E6ABE9FD82FCD3" pageId="28" pageNumber="29" type="discussion">
<paragraph id="8BE44E5E81370D2224E6ABE9FB0DFC9B" blockId="28.[151,1437,151,861]" pageId="28" pageNumber="29">
<emphasis id="B92F924C81370D2224E6ABE9FEB3FF3E" bold="true" box="[199,317,151,176]" pageId="28" pageNumber="29">Comment</emphasis>
. The above description is very similar to that of Lambdin and Kosztarab (1977) except that they do not mention the areolations in the derm and, whilst the cribriform plates are in transverse rows, it was very difficult to determine how many rows; there could be as many as seven. It is here considered that the most posterior row is on abdominal segment IV and, if there are six or seven rows and, if they are segmentally arranged, this would mean the most anterior row would probably be on the thorax. However, the most anterior pores appear to be posterior to the metathoracic leg stubs, suggesting that perhaps the rows of cribriform plates are all on the abdomen and therefore not segmentally arranged. In addition, Lambdin and Kosztarab (1977) considered that there were four sizes of 8-shaped pores on the dorsum but, on the only available specimen, although the size of the largest pores do vary quite a lot (see size range above), the size of the large pores do not fall into two groups as there are intermediates. We therefore consider there are only really three sizes of 8-shaped pores on the dorsum. The following combination of character-states diagnoses
